What Are PBT Granules?

PBT granules are thermoplastic polyester pellets made by polymerizing butylene glycol with terephthalic acid or its derivatives. These granules are then used in injection molding, extrusion, and other manufacturing techniques to create high-precision and durable components.PBT’s polymer structure lends it outstanding thermal stability, moisture resistance, and a low coefficient of friction. Key Properties of PBT Granules

  • High Mechanical Strength: PBT exhibits excellent tensile and compressive strength, especially in reinforced grades like 30% GF FR PBT and VALOX DR51.

  • Thermal Stability: PBT granules can withstand continuous temperatures up to 150°C, making grades like VALOX 420 suitable for engine and electrical applications.

  • Electrical Insulation: PBT’s low dielectric constant makes it ideal for electrical housings and switchgear.

  • Chemical Resistance: Grades such as VALOX DR48 and DR51 SABIC resist acids, fuels, and alkalis.

  • Low Moisture Absorption: PBT maintains its dimensional stability even in humid environments.

Manufacturing and Processing

PBT granules are produced through a condensation polymerization process. The resin is extruded and pelletized into granules. These are then processed through techniques such as:

  • Injection Molding

  • Extrusion Molding

  • Blow Molding

Many grades such as VALOX 357X and VALOX 420SEO are glass-reinforced to improve stiffness and reduce warpage.

Applications of PBT Granules

1. Automotive Industry

PBT is extensively used in the automotive sector for components that must endure heat, mechanical stress, and exposure to chemicals.

Applications:

  • Electrical connectors – VALOX 420VALOX 420SEO

  • Engine covers and valve parts – VALOX DR5130% GF FR PBT

  • Dashboard components and interior housings – VALOX 357VALOX DR48

2. Electrical and Electronics Industry

Its excellent dielectric strength and flame retardancy make PBT ideal for electrical components.

Applications:

  • Switchgear housings – VALOX 420SE0

  • Relays and circuit board supports – VALOX 357X15% GF FR PBT

  • Consumer electronics casings – DR51 SABIC

3. Consumer Goods

PBT is favored for products requiring strength, surface finish, and aesthetic appeal.

Applications:

  • Appliance parts (e.g., washing machines, kitchen tools) – VALOX 325

  • Power tool housings – 30% GLASS FILLED PBT RESIN

4. Industrial Applications

Industries use PBT for machinery parts where performance and precision are critical.

Applications:

  • Gears and bearing housings – VALOX DR51VALOX 357

  • Conveyor and pump components – VALOX 420SEO

5. Medical Devices

PBT's chemical resistance and ability to be sterilized make it useful in certain medical equipment.

Applications:

  • Surgical instruments – VALOX DR48

  • Diagnostic device housings – VALOX 325VALOX 420
